Difference between revisions of "User:Kebap"

From Mudlet
Jump to navigation Jump to search
m
Line 30: Line 30:
 
: What the function does. In this case, it is just a non-existing function with the only purpose to show, how to write documentation for functions
 
: What the function does. In this case, it is just a non-existing function with the only purpose to show, how to write documentation for functions
 
: Returns whatever the function returns.  
 
: Returns whatever the function returns.  
: See also: [[Manual:Lua_Functions#paste|paste]]
+
 
 +
See also:  
 +
[[Manual:Lua_Functions#paste|paste]],
 +
[[Manual:Lua_Functions#paste|paste]]
  
 
{{note}} Available since Mudlet 3.5
 
{{note}} Available since Mudlet 3.5
Line 43: Line 46:
  
 
;Example
 
;Example
<lua>
+
<syntaxhighlight lang="lua">
 
--a small example snippet of the function in action
 
--a small example snippet of the function in action
 
--the comments up top should introduce it/explain what the snippet does
 
--the comments up top should introduce it/explain what the snippet does
 
functionName("arg1", "arg2")
 
functionName("arg1", "arg2")
</lua>
+
</syntaxhighlight>

Revision as of 21:14, 9 August 2018

About me

Mudlet user and script developer, hailing from MorgenGrauen (German).

Projects

Examples for Wiki formatting

functionName

functionName(arg1, arg2, [optionalArg3])
What the function does. In this case, it is just a non-existing function with the only purpose to show, how to write documentation for functions
Returns whatever the function returns.

See also: paste, paste

Note Note: Available since Mudlet 3.5

Parameters
  • arg1:
What arg1 is/does. Passed as a string.
  • arg2:
What arg2 is/does. Passed as a string.
  • optionalArg3
(optional) The name needn't be telling. Relevant is to mark optional arguments at the start of this line (with text "optional" in brackets) and in the function definition line (with [these] brackets)
Example
--a small example snippet of the function in action
--the comments up top should introduce it/explain what the snippet does
functionName("arg1", "arg2")